Html5+Css3(选择器序列,标签选择器,id选择器,类选择器,通配符*,后代选择器,交集选择器,并集选择器,属性选择器)

CSS 概述

  • CSS:Cascading Style Sheet,层叠样式表。CSS 的作用就是给 HTML 页面标签添加各种样式,定义网页的显示效果。CSS 将网页内容和显示样式进行分离,提高了显示功能。

CSS 语法

  • 语法格式:(其实就是键值对)

选择器{ 属性名: 属性值; 属性名: 属性值; } 或者可以写成:

选择器 {
    属性名: 属性值; 
    属性名: 属性值;
    属性名: 属性值; 
    属性名: 属性值; 
}
选择器 {
    属性名: 属性值; 
    属性名: 属性值;
    属性名: 属性值; 
    属性名: 属性值; 
}

CSS 的一些简单常见的属性

  • 以下属性值中,括号中的内容表示 sublime 中的快捷键。
  1. 字体颜色:(c)
  • color:red;
  • color 属性的值,可以是英语单词,比如 red、blue、yellow 等等;也可以是 rgb、十六进制(后期详细讲)。
  1. 字号大小:(fos)
  • font-size:40px;
  • font 就是“字体”,size 就是“尺寸”。px 是“像素”。单位必须加,不加不行。
  1. 背景颜色:(bgc)
  • background-color: blue;
  • background 就是“背景”。
  1. 加粗:(fwb)
  • font-weight: bold;
  • font 是“字体” weight 是“重量”的意思,bold 粗。
  1. 不加粗:(fwn)
  • font-weight: normal;
  • normal 就是正常的意思。
  1. 斜体:(fsi)
  • font-style: italic;
  • italic 就是“斜体”。
  1. 不斜体:(fsn)
  • font-style: normal;
  1. 下划线:(tdu)
  • text-decoration: underline;
  • decoration 就是“装饰”的意思。
  1. 没有下划线:(tdn)

text-decoration:none;

CSS 的书写方式

  • CSS 的书写方式有三种:
  1. 行内样式:在某个特定的标签里采用 style 属性。范围只针对此标签。

  2. 内嵌样式(内联样式):在页面的 head 标签里里采用